logo

Output 9743332bc0c21f26bd789ef08bc4800dc504efe9bbba71b1f70c037397a52030:0

value
26500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94b863c3308dd305db884cdaaa5c5117aa7fbcf8 OP_EQUALVERIFY OP_CHECKSIG
address
1EZMu1gDzvgMjTtps9Fraq9Mn7LxpLWjtx
transaction
9743332bc0c21f26bd789ef08bc4800dc504efe9bbba71b1f70c037397a52030